Wa.make it strong.We make it easy <br /> OTA <br /> ELECTRICAL INSTRUCTIONS <br /> ELECTRIC UNDERGUIDE AND RECESSED TOPGUIDE <br /> BONDING-All Coverstar pool cover systems require bonding.The electrician should provide a <br /> #18 AWG solid copper ground from the pool equipment pad to a ground clamp on the electrical <br /> conduit inside the housing,with a 2-foot tail that will be attached to the mechanism ground bar. <br /> Be sure to follow local codes in all instances.Note: Place bonding wires at each end of the <br /> housing. <br /> GROUND FAULT CIRCUIT INTERRUPTER -A GFCI must be used in the electrical supply <br /> line for the motor.This should be on a separate dedicated circuit only for the pool cover. <br /> RUNNING WIRES -Bring 110y to the key switch. From the panel to the key switch,run 3 <br /> wires(hot,neutral and an unbroken ground). From the key switch to the motor end of the <br /> housing run 4 wires(two directionals,a neutral and an unbroken ground). Terminate the wires in <br /> a weather tight"J"box. The motor is 110 volt,3/4 HP with full load amperage of 8.8 amps. <br /> Follow all applicable codes regarding wire size,grounding, connections,etc. <br /> KEYSNTTCHES -Mount a standard,single gang,all weather junction box for the key switch at <br /> a point where 100%of the pool is visible. This is a mandatory requirement to meet ASTM <br /> safety standards. The key switch should not be placed in the mechanism box.This does not <br /> meet UL standards or code. <br /> OPTIONS-Coverstar has several different wiring options that includes limit switches,wireless <br /> remote control,water feature shutoffs etc. Contact your Coverstar distributor for details. <br /> Note: Builder is responsible to bring proper electric lines,conduit and bonding to the mechanism. <br /> Sub-panel with dedicated <br /> 110 Volt,15 an breaker <br /> Key switch is mounted in a and OM <br /> standard all-weather UL listedr-* <br /> single gang box.
